Job Description
As a corporate finance analyst, you will report to our Director of Finance. You will be responsible for analyzing key business performance metrics and identifying internal organic performance improvement opportunities. Additionally, you will work with the Director of Finance to assess the balance sheet to determine the best plan of action for capital structuring (e.g., refinancing, raising debt/equity) as well as investment decisions (e.g., what our highest ROI projects are). As someone with strong financial acumen and the ability to turn numbers into insights, you will be a pivotal team member expected to help maximize shareholder value.
Responsibilities
- Provide executives with clear insights on drivers of business growth, risks, and opportunities.
- Gather and assess financial results. Prepare financial reporting deliverables and explain trends and business drivers. Uncover areas that are underperforming.
- Execute financial due diligence projects on both the buy- and sell-side.
- Determine appropriate valuations of investment projects through detailed analysis (e.g., modeling ROI, IRR, payback period).
- Strive for increased shareholder value through your internal and external assessments and recommendations.
Skills
- Education: A bachelor’s degree in Business, Finance, Economics, or similar
- 2+ years of financial analysis experience in investment banking, management consulting, financial planning, and/or corporate strategy
- Experience creating financial models within a corporate finance setting
- Experience developing analytical frameworks and communicating financial concepts
- The ability to spot patterns from numbers
